Land Characteristics in Njoro

The one-acre plots in Njoro feature:

  • Rich volcanic soil ideal for agriculture
  • Gentle to moderate topography
  • Murram access roads (some seasonal)
  • Partial electricity connectivity
  • Water available through boreholes or piped systems

Current Market Prices

LocationPrice Range (per acre)Title Status
Njoro CentralKsh 3.5M - Ksh 5MFreehold/Ready Title
Mau Narok Road AreaKsh 2M - Ksh 3MLeasehold (99 years)
Egerton University EnvironsKsh 4M - Ksh 6MFreehold/Ready Title

Development Potential

The one-acre parcels in Njoro are zoned as General Land, allowing for:

  • Residential development (subject to county approvals)
  • Agricultural use including horticulture and dairy farming
  • Light commercial ventures like agri-businesses
  • Educational institutions (near Egerton University)

Key Advantages of Njoro Land

  • Proximity to Egerton University and research institutions
  • Growing infrastructure including the Mau Narok Road upgrade
  • Cool climate favorable for various agricultural activities
  • Increasing demand from both local and Nairobi-based investors

Yes, most one-acre plots can be subdivided into quarter-acre parcels, subject to county government approval and meeting minimum plot size requirements of at least 1/8 acre.
Njoro has standard county building codes requiring setbacks of at least 15 feet from roads and boundaries. Some areas near Egerton University have additional architectural guidelines.
Most one-acre plots have access to electricity through nearby transformers. Water is primarily through boreholes, though some areas are being connected to the county water system.
Njoro offers stable land appreciation (10-15% annually), proximity to educational institutions, fertile agricultural land, and upcoming infrastructure projects like road upgrades.
